The most popular lottery games in Malaysia are 4D-style draws, which let players bet on four-digit numbers for fixed prizes and jackpot payouts.

To participate in Malaysian lottery games, players must be at least 21 years old and possess a valid Malaysian identification card or passport. Most online lottery sites require account registration, age verification, and agreement to local terms and conditions. Bets are placed in Malaysian Ringgit (MYR), and winnings are subject to local tax laws. Players should check each operator’s specific rules before placing bets.

  • Magnum 4D: Magnum 4D is operated by Magnum Corporation and is Malaysia’s first legal 4D lottery. Players select a four-digit number from 0000 to 9999. Draws occur every Wednesday, Saturday, and Sunday. The prize structure includes first, second, and third prizes, plus special and consolation prizes. Magnum 4D is widely accessible at retail outlets and online platforms.
  • Sports Toto 4D: Sports Toto 4D is managed by Sports Toto Malaysia. Players choose a four-digit number, with draws held on Wednesday, Saturday, and Sunday. The game offers fixed prizes for matching numbers in exact order, with additional draws for 4D Jackpot and 4D Zodiac variants. Sports Toto 4D is available both in-store and online.
  • Da Ma Cai 1+3D: Da Ma Cai 1+3D is run by Pan Malaysian Pools. Players pick a four-digit number, and draws take place three times a week. The 1+3D format includes a main prize and three supplementary prizes, with extra options like 3D and 6D games. Da Ma Cai is accessible at authorized outlets and online.
  • Grand Dragon 4D (GD Lotto): Grand Dragon 4D, also known as GD Lotto, is popular in Malaysia and neighboring countries. Players select a four-digit number, with daily draws. The prize structure includes first, second, and third prizes, plus special and consolation categories. GD Lotto is accessible online and through local agents.
  • Sandakan STC 4D: Sandakan STC 4D is operated by Sandakan Turf Club in Sabah. Players choose a four-digit number, with draws held on Wednesday, Saturday, and Sunday. The game offers fixed prizes for matching numbers, and is available at licensed outlets and online platforms.

Online lottery is strictly prohibited under Malaysian law. The Betting Act 1953 and the Common Gaming Houses Act 1953 ban all forms of online gambling, including lottery betting, for Malaysian residents. No Malaysian authority issues licenses for online lottery operators. Only a few land-based lottery operators, such as Magnum 4D, Sports Toto, and Damacai, hold valid licenses for physical draws. These licenses do not extend to online lottery sales or betting. Malaysian players seeking online lottery options often join international lottery sites based offshore, which operate outside Malaysian jurisdiction. However, participation in these sites carries legal risks under local law.

Fees and Taxes on Lottery Winnings in Malaysia

Lottery winnings in Malaysia are not subject to personal income tax for players. The Inland Revenue Board of Malaysia (LHDN) does not classify lottery prizes as taxable income. When you win a lottery prize, you receive the full advertised amount without deductions for tax. For example, if you win ₱12.5 million from Magnum 4D, Sports Toto, or Da Ma Cai, you collect the entire ₱12.5 million. However, lottery operators pay a gaming tax to the government, but this does not affect your payout. If you play on international lottery sites, check if those platforms apply any fees or withholdings.
